To anybody interested in this piece...what are your pros/cons so far? Not trying to slam the piece or anything because its great but I do have a few concerns..

Pros: The portrait and the mane is perfect I really enjoy the visual


Cons: I cant help but see the base as a clutter of not so pleasing greys and silvers. Without stepping on anybody's toes ..i see it as the Sabretooth figure is near perfect but they posed him standing on junk..twisted metal and rubble. has nothing to do with the character himself. I can see why they keep putting him on a snow base to represent a beast of nature in the wilderness but this XM base loses me. I want to like it more than I do. Second, why is the sculpt so smooth? He lacks texture and definition.

Of course its just my opinion, which can change but as of right now I would just like to hear different views on the piece.
